Hello, I know of three makers but there's bound to be more :rolleyes:

The pouches I have are an open tan G2 and a black Chris Reeve's own model which, btw, can fit both large and small Sebenzas and has a snap closure if that's what you like. The snug fitting custom sheaths may involve you taking off the pocket clip.

Here's the three I know anyway ;

Gary W. Graley (aka G2)
Mike Tea (aka MikeT)
Vess Leatherworks

I'm not sure if all / any of these gentlemen would be making sheaths to order, but these are good ones that you may find for sale already.
(CRK's own model is available in black or tan and can be found on their website)
